Patrick,
Such offers exist in some countries and not others all the time. I remember a time when here in Canada you had barely any access to online music streaming services such as Spotify or TV streaming services such as Netflix. They were all available in the US but not Canada just because they had not yet set it up and dealt with all the legalities involved. The same applied to Amazon, a Canadian version of Audible has only been around for 2 or so years and to this day there is no option in Canada to set up a family account where I can add, for example, my wife as a family member so she can use her Amazon account but take advantage of the Prime subscription I have. You could just as well call that discrimination, but I see little point in that because I'm sure sooner or later Amazon will have that option available. The subscription model of Jaws is to my knowledge only available in the US right now because in other countries Jaws licenses are handled by Vispero partners and distributors so there is probably a little more involved in setting this up in every single market where Jaws is available than you think. I have a feeling Jaws would probably like everybody to be on this model whether it's free for a while as it is now or not.

Re: JAWS2020 June Update, Build 2006.12 + What's New
Andrew Law
It wont work with audio ducking on because like they said JAWS is still outputting audio eeven when it is not talking, as in a silent track. This would cause all other audio on the pc to be ducked, because JAWS still has use of the audio channel.

Re: attempting settings export still crashes wizard, with June update
John Covici
What I have done in the past is to just take the whole settings folder
-- in my case its c:\users\<user name>\appdata\roaming\freedom scientific\jaws\2020\settings\enu where username is your username and put it in the same directory on your other computer or whereever you need it to be. I have had some trouble also with the export wizard, but what I did worked for me and I hope it works for you -- you might want to back up the current folder in case something bad happens.
